Campaign Bootcamp is now accepting applications for their upcoming residential campaign trainings!

Campaign Bootcamp is a week-long camp designed to give individuals the tools, confidence, and support to run effective campaigns and contribute to movements that combat injustice. After the week-long camp, participants are given a year of mentoring, support, and opportunities to encourage them to participate in or start their own campaigns.

Over the course of the week, 35 participants will be taken through the different stages of creating and running an effective campaign, with chances to engage with each other, learn from other’s experiences, and develop practical tools for maximizing the effectiveness of their campaign and finding their own place in the movement.

The camp was first held in 2013 by a group of campaigners who sought to share the knowledge they had gained in the NGO sector, and is now gearing up for its 12th and 13th sessions. Bootcamp 12 will take place May 20-25, 2018 (applications due March 23) and Bootcamp 13 will take place July 15-20, 2018 (applications due April 10). Both will take place at Gilwell Park in Epping Forest.

Scholarships are available, and about 80% of participants attend on a scholarship, which covers the full cost of training. Campaign Bootcamp believes in the leadership of those most impacted by injustice, and has scholarships for BME campaigners, LGBTQ+ campaigners, women campaigning for fairness and justice in the UK, and many more.
